The Burton Street Social Worker position at St Vincent's Health Australia involves providing support and coordinated care for young people aged 16 to 21, particularly those facing complex needs related to trauma and substance use. The role requires a degree in Social Work and experience in trauma-informed care, with a focus on collaboration and community partnerships
Job Summary
The role involves providing referrals, advocacy, and coordinated care to connect clients with mental health, housing, and justice services.
Staff will contribute to the ADS VAN crisis roster delivering clinical assessment and risk management for domestic violence and child wellbeing concerns.
Employees receive benefits including discounted gym access, private health insurance, and a government salary sacrifice program.
